GARVEY "HARD HAT AREA" VOL. 1
Garvey "The Chosen One" and his producer Rico Anderson of Triple Team Entertainment had
a party to celebrate the release of Garvey's new CD Hard Hat Area Volume 1. This wasn't your average listening
party - it had tattoo artists, ice sculptures, a model call, an open bar, and DJ Flexx from WPGC kept the dance floor packed
all night. You can pick up Hard Hat Area at a Downtown Locker Room (DTLR) location near you.

The DMV invaded Ocean City with full force. The Go-Go band UCB, fresh off of their
MTV Awards appearance, and rap heavyweights the Oy Boyz, performed live at Castaways (64th Street on the Bay). UCB started
the night off playing before a packed house (big ups to everyone that came down from DC, and also to the folks from UM
Eastern Shore). After the first set the Oy Boyz hit the stage to perform several hits from their new CD. Then UCB
returned accompanied by the incredible vocals of Ms. Kim (from Rare Essence). Their version of "Run This Town" was
crazy, then they shut it down with the classics "Pieces of Me" and "Sexy Lady". It was a totally drama-free
night - shouts out to Envious Couture and Suni for putting together a great event.
